The judge who presided over one of the trials involving Dilan and Engin Polat, a couple that Turkey has been talking about for months, has decided to recuse himself. In his written petition, the judge claimed that Dilan Polat's lawyer had exerted pressure on him to have a private meeting. The judge stated that he had rejected the lawyer's requests and persistent attitude during and after the trial.

An unexpected development occurred in the attack case where Dilan and Engin Polat were tried for instigation. According to the news of İhsan Yalçın from Kanal D, the judge of Küçükçekmece 3rd Criminal Court of First Instance, where the Polat couple was tried for instigation, withdrew from the case.
DILAN POLAT'S LAWYER PRESSURED
The judge explained the reason for the withdrawal decision in a petition. The judge claimed in the petition that Dilan Polat's lawyer, Lawyer Hüseyin Kaya, put pressure on him to meet privately. The judge also stated that he rejected the incidents and requests of the lawyer during and after the trial, but Kaya continued his insistent attitude.
THE JUDGE'S PETITION EMERGED
In the petition containing the withdrawal request, the judge stated, "After the identification of the file with the main number belonging to our court and the establishment of an interim decision, it was understood that the defendant Dilan Polat's lawyer, Lawyer Hüseyin Kaya, verbally threatened the judge in the presence of the bailiff in the corridor between the courtroom and the office and forcibly entered the judge's office on 03.06.2024 around 11:00. The judge recorded this situation and filed a complaint, and legal proceedings were initiated against Lawyer Hüseyin Kaya with the approval of the Ministry of Justice dated 03.06.2024 and numbered .... In addition, the trial judge stated that Lawyer Hüseyin Kaya tried to pressure him to meet in his office, but this meeting did not take place in the office, and stated that his belief in performing his duty was undermined due to all these incidents and therefore requested withdrawal from the case.".
WHAT HAPPENED?
In the operations carried out on November 1, 2023, in 6 provinces centered in Istanbul and subsequently, 24 suspects, including Dilan Polat and her husband Engin Polat, were detained. While 16 of the suspects, including Dilan Polat, Engin Polat, and Sıla Doğu, were arrested, the court ruled for the appointment of trustees to 27 companies.
At the Bakırköy Women's Closed Prison, where Dilan Polat, who is detained within the scope of the investigation conducted by the Anatolian Chief Public Prosecutor's Office, is imprisoned, her lawyer wrote a petition to the prosecutor's office, stating that it is not suitable for her client to stay in prison due to health problems and requested her release. Evaluating the petition, the chief prosecutor's office decided to refer Dilan Polat to the forensic medicine institution.
